We have an existing project written in .NET on Visual Studio 2013 with database working in singularity with MYSQL.
Details are as follows:
1) Project displayed locally via a web site(Template).
2) Implementation of the design is based on MVC framework.
3) The server side is based on .NET language.
4) Database utilized on MySQL.
5) Integrated API’s in List form, combined with bubble sort algorithm.
6) The online search works simultaneously with API Web Service/Provider. The results are returned by listing from the lowest price of deal to the highest. It is sorted via the bubble sort algorithm, as mentioned.
1. Main requirement and the purpose of this whole project. We have several options on website that gives the ability to search flights, hotels, concert events and sport events individually. This is done by fetching the existing data from the API’s. What is needed is to take the data received from the API of each category and create our own data by generating a package deal that incorporates flights, hotels, concerts and sport events for a customer.
For instance: Client searches flights and is returned with results, then client searches hotels and is returned with results, etc.
What is required: What we need is an option that the client shall receive a generated package deal taken from the returned results, and we build the client the best deal that offers the lowest price for flights, hotels, sport events and concerts, all in one result. This process will work and should ONLY be done using the “Genetic Algorithm”. For more information, please refer to the link here: [login to view URL]
Of course, not necessarily all of them, but perhaps generating the options for them, with the following combinations:
Flights + Hotels, Flights + Concerts, Hotels + Concerts, Hotels + Sport Events and etc.
2. Integrating additional API’s(you will be provided with) – Currently our API’s, such as one from expedia, allows us to search using cityID, but we have another API that does not allow this and we have to find a way to allow all API’s to work together.
3. Repair existing database when choosing deal from returned results(Not all store the one that I chose. Problem with API) and to make sure that there is proper re-direction to the origin site of purchase.
4. Re-designing the websites’ background to look nicer(add something instead of the white background displayed in all pages)
5. Remove existing cart
For any further explanation, I’m happy to conduct with you a skype session.